Magnetic Product Description:

This rectangular block magnet has a length of 30mm, a width of 12.5mm and a thickness of 3.3mm. It has a magnetic flux of 2119 Gauss and a pull force against 5mm mild steel of 4.7 kilos. It uses the AMF magnetic part number 22009A

Uses for our rare earth block magnets:

This Rare Earth magnet is such a handy size that it is a popular, all-purpose magnet and is often used by visual display companies when creating internal shop fittings and advertising display units. Multiple magnets of this size can be glued into position for attraction and used to create an invisible seal, closure or a lid for containers or closure mechanism on storage compartments. The long and thin shape can be used in similar fashion to a cylinder-shaped magnet and stood on its smallest face to allow easy, repeated removal and replacement by hand. This can be useful on magnetic whiteboards and for educational or artistic purposes.

The most common coating for Neodymium magnets is Nickel + Copper + Nickel (Ni + Cu + Ni). This coating offers the magnet relatively good protection from corrosion and passive applications. If the magnet will be exposed to moisture or liquid then consider the use of an organic coating such as Epoxy. A hard wearing coating, Epoxy is suited to applications where the magnet will come under some friction or knocking.

Neodymium magnets are offered in several different grades. The first section N30-54 has an operating temperature of up to 80 degrees. Most of our stock only goes up to N38. The second section, denoted with the "M" prefix after the grade has an operating temperature 100 degrees. After this the grades are "H", "SH", "UH" & "EH". In order for the magnet to withstand a higher operating temperature, during production more of the raw material PrNd is incorporated as these elements have a naturally occurring resistance to high temperatures.
